Understanding the Right Side Lower Control Arm Importance and Functionality


The right side lower control arm is a critical component of a vehicle’s suspension system. It plays an essential role in maintaining the alignment of the vehicle’s wheels and ensures a smooth ride. Understanding its function, structure, and maintenance can help vehicle owners take better care of their cars and improve overall safety and performance.


What is a Lower Control Arm?


The lower control arm is part of the suspension system that connects the vehicle's chassis to its wheels. Typically found in vehicles with independent front suspension, control arms are pivotal in managing the movement and stability of the vehicle. They help in appropriately distributing the forces that occur when driving, allowing for good handling, stability, and comfort while driving.


Importance of the Right Side Lower Control Arm


As the name suggests, the right side lower control arm is specifically the component located on the right side of the vehicle, usually the passenger side for most vehicles. Its primary functions include


1. Wheel Alignment The right side lower control arm helps keep the wheel aligned with the vehicle's chassis. Proper alignment ensures even tire wear and enhances the vehicle's handling characteristics. Misalignment can lead to uneven tire wear, affecting performance and safety.


2. Suspension Management It works in conjunction with other suspension components to absorb shocks from the road, providing a smoother ride. It allows for vertical movement of the wheel while restraining any lateral movement, which is crucial for maintaining stability during turns and sudden maneuvers.


3. Load Bearing The lower control arm supports the weight of the vehicle while driving, accommodating the various forces that act on the suspension system, especially during aggressive driving or when navigating rough terrain.


Structure of the Lower Control Arm

Typically, a lower control arm is made from steel or aluminum, engineered to be both lightweight and strong. It consists of a pivot point (where it attaches to the chassis) and a ball joint (where it connects to the wheel assembly). In some designs, the control arm may have bushings that help absorb vibrations and provide flexibility during movement.


Common Issues and Symptoms


The wear and tear on lower control arms can lead to several issues that impact the vehicle's performance. Common symptoms of a failing right side lower control arm include


- Excessive Vibration When driving, you may notice unusual vibrations in the steering wheel. - Poor Handling Difficulty in steering or maintaining control of the vehicle during turns can indicate an issue with the control arm. - Uneven Tire Wear Inspecting the tires for uneven wear patterns can hint at alignment issues due to a problematic control arm. - Clunking Noises Sounds originating from the suspension while driving over bumps can suggest wear in the control arm or its associated components.


Maintenance and Replacement


Regular maintenance of the suspension system is crucial to ensure the longevity of the lower control arm. Vehicle owners should have their suspension components inspected during routine maintenance. If problems are identified, such as worn bushings or damaged arms, it is essential to address them promptly to prevent further complications.


In many cases, replacing a lower control arm can restore a vehicle's handling, safety, and comfort. Professional mechanics typically perform the replacement, as it requires specialized knowledge and tools to ensure proper installation and alignment.
